(function () {
  'use strict';

  // ===================== CONFIG =====================
  // 'block' - completely removes getBattery()/navigator.battery, so calls
  //           throw/are undefined, exactly as if the API never existed
  //           (indistinguishable from browsers that dropped it, e.g.
  //           current Firefox/Safari).
  // 'fixed' - keeps the API present but always returns a fixed, plausible
  //           100%-charged / plugged-in state instead of real battery data.
  const MODE = 'block'; // <-- change to 'fixed' if you prefer a fake value
  // ====================================================

  const hasGetBattery = typeof navigator.getBattery === 'function';
  const legacyProps = ['battery', 'mozBattery', 'webkitBattery'].filter((p) => p in navigator);

  if (!hasGetBattery && legacyProps.length === 0) {
    return; // nothing to do, API not present at all
  }

  if (MODE === 'block') {
    // --- Fully remove the API ---

    if (hasGetBattery) {
      try {
        Object.defineProperty(navigator, 'getBattery', {
          configurable: true,
          value: undefined,
        });
      } catch (e) {
        try {
          const proto = Object.getPrototypeOf(navigator);
          Object.defineProperty(proto, 'getBattery', {
            configurable: true,
            value: undefined,
          });
        } catch (e2) {
          console.warn('[block-battery] failed to remove getBattery', e2);
        }
      }
    }

    legacyProps.forEach((prop) => {
      try {
        Object.defineProperty(navigator, prop, {
          configurable: true,
          get() { return undefined; },
        });
      } catch (e) {
        console.warn(`[block-battery] failed to remove navigator.${prop}`, e);
      }
    });

    return;
  }

  if (MODE === 'fixed') {
    // --- Return a fixed, plausible battery state ---

    // Fully charged and plugged in: the most common/least informative
    // state (doesn't reveal usage patterns, discharge rate, or battery
    // health, which were previously used for cross-session tracking).
    const FAKE_BATTERY_STATE = {
      charging: true,
      chargingTime: 0,
      dischargingTime: Infinity,
      level: 1.0,
    };

    function createFakeBatteryManager() {
      const listeners = {
        chargingchange: [],
        chargingtimechange: [],
        dischargingtimechange: [],
        levelchange: [],
      };

      const state = { ...FAKE_BATTERY_STATE };

      // Minimal EventTarget-like object exposing the same interface as the
      // real BatteryManager (properties + on*change handlers + addEventListener)
      const battery = {
        get charging() { return state.charging; },
        get chargingTime() { return state.chargingTime; },
        get dischargingTime() { return state.dischargingTime; },
        get level() { return state.level; },

        onchargingchange: null,
        onchargingtimechange: null,
        ondischargingtimechange: null,
        onlevelchange: null,

        addEventListener(type, listener) {
          if (listeners[type] && typeof listener === 'function') {
            listeners[type].push(listener);
          }
        },
        removeEventListener(type, listener) {
          if (listeners[type]) {
            const idx = listeners[type].indexOf(listener);
            if (idx !== -1) listeners[type].splice(idx, 1);
          }
        },
        dispatchEvent(event) {
          // Never actually triggered since state never changes, but kept
          // for interface completeness in case a site calls it directly.
          const type = event && event.type;
          if (listeners[type]) {
            listeners[type].forEach((fn) => {
              try { fn.call(battery, event); } catch (e) {}
            });
          }
          const handlerName = 'on' + type;
          if (typeof battery[handlerName] === 'function') {
            try { battery[handlerName].call(battery, event); } catch (e) {}
          }
          return true;
        },
      };

      return battery;
    }

    const fakeBattery = createFakeBatteryManager();
    const fakeBatteryPromise = Promise.resolve(fakeBattery);

    if (hasGetBattery) {
      try {
        Object.defineProperty(navigator, 'getBattery', {
          configurable: true,
          writable: true,
          value: function () {
            return fakeBatteryPromise;
          },
        });
      } catch (e) {
        try {
          const proto = Object.getPrototypeOf(navigator);
          Object.defineProperty(proto, 'getBattery', {
            configurable: true,
            writable: true,
            value: function () {
              return fakeBatteryPromise;
            },
          });
        } catch (e2) {
          console.warn('[spoof-battery] failed to override getBattery', e2);
        }
      }
    }

    legacyProps.forEach((prop) => {
      try {
        Object.defineProperty(navigator, prop, {
          configurable: true,
          get() { return fakeBattery; },
        });
      } catch (e) {
        console.warn(`[spoof-battery] failed to override navigator.${prop}`, e);
      }
    });

    return;
  }

  console.warn('[battery-privacy-script] unknown MODE value:', MODE);
})();
